Trying to view a PDF in Adobe Reader XI on Windows 7 64bit, when I go to page 2 I get the message pop up "There was an error processing a page.  There was a problem reading this document (110)."  Page 2 is then displayed as a blank page.  Other pages are OK.

I get the same problem with Adobe Reader DC.  Also tried on Windows 10 with Adobe Reader DC, same problem.

PDF opens OK in Google Chrome, Microsoft Edge and Foxit PDF Reader.

PDF version is 1.4 (Acrobat 5.x), PDF Producer is iText 5.3.3

When I go to properties->fonts, it displays Helvetica, Helvetica-Bold and Helvetica-BoldOblique and says "Gathering font information....(0%)" and stays stuck on 0%.

This happening on a few PDFs generated by various parties, please help

    Hello Danz,

    Sorry for the delayed response and inconvenience caused. We analyzed the PDF file you shared and found that this is a Font issue in the PDF file as the appropriate fonts are not embedded in the PDF file.

    Looking at the information you have shared above, this seems to be a file specific issue where the files created using 3rd party pdf makers are not being supported by any of the Reader version.

    Google chrome, Microsoft Edge uses their own pdf viewers and that works on different mechanism. 

    If you are able to open the other pdf files without any issues then there might be problem with the iText files, so you can try installing the Reader font pack, could be a possibility author does not embed the appropriate font into the document and that's causing problem Adobe - Adobe Reader : For Windows : Adobe Acrobat Reader DC Font Pack (Continuous)
